On Fri, 2003-07-25 at 06:33, Rus Foster wrote:
> I've beenfinding that when running gaim that its causing X to crash back
> down to the shell prompt. This has happened with both vesa, nv and nvidia
> drivers. Doing a latest buildworld still hasn't helped. Anyone got any
> insite in to this?

This is more of an anecdote than anything else, since I don't have any
systems running -current at the moment, but it might be helpful in
tracking it down.

I haven't had it crash X, but it tends to die with SIGILL when someone
logs out; turning on "show offline buddies" makes it happen less often. 

If it's dying after sending a partial X protocol request to the server,
that would probably do it; XFree86 doesn't seem to deal with that very
well, in my experience.
